Bartholomew House Unit

Posted by David Davis, MP for Haltemprice and Howden, at 12:05, Wed 1 August 2007:

The Humber Mental Health Trust has decided not to proceed with the proposed closure of the Bartholomew House Unit in Goole. This Unit provides mental health care to residents in the Howden area too.

I shared the concerns of many residents who opposed this closure and my researcher Andrew Percy has spoken to many local people about this facility.

The Unit is now saved for the next 3 to 5 years during which time I hope the funding problems facing the Humber Mental Health Trust can be resolved.
